    I never had any issues with the LEDs in my Amigo, but am definitely aware of the issue. My uncle had a Jeep Rubicon with LEDs and he said he drove over the pass in a blizzard and the headlights had a 1/4" of ice over the headlights. It was during the day so it didn't matter. I assume he had the lights on the whole time or else the story wouldn't make sense. I feel like my lights don't have any way to hold snow, so even a little heat should let it clear, but something like a Fox body Mustang would probably have problems. I'm either going to drive around during this storm for fun, or pull it into the garage and try to replace the clutch and install the low gears.

    These lights, and the ones I had on the Amigo have a built-in, powered cooling fan in the back of the housing, so they definitely produce some amount of heat.
